US: Wall Street opens higher on Disney boost, healthcare earnings
[BENGALURU] US stocks opened higher on Wednesday as Disney's surprise quarterly profit and a slate of upbeat results from healthcare companies lifted sentiment ahead of service sector data.
The Dow Jones Industrial Average rose 96.31 points or 0.36 per cent at the open to 26,924.78.
The S&P 500 opened higher by 13.75 points or 0.42 per cent at 3,320.26. The Nasdaq Composite gained 26.71 points or 0.24 per cent to 10,967.87 at the opening bell.
